Europe and the World
Europe and the World explores the international role of the European Union across six thematic areas. These vital themes reflect rising tensions around the globe, a pressing need for renewed cooperation with state and non-state actors, and the demand for a comparative perspective in order to obtain a better understanding and learn to cope with diversity:
- Peace and security;
- Promotion of universal values and human rights;
- Poverty alleviation and sustainable development;
- Global trade and financial interdependence;
- Global digital connectivity, market regulation, and cooperation on technological developments affecting world affairs;
- Global pandemics and health cooperation, especially with a view to tackling rising inequalities.
